    How much does a Lab Operations Manager make in Georgia?

    As of Aug 13, 2026, the average annual pay for a Lab Operations Manager in Georgia is $53,581 a year.

    Just in case you need a simple salary calculator, that works out to be approximately $25.76 an hour. This is the equivalent of $1,030/week or $4,465/month.

    While ZipRecruiter is seeing salaries as high as $100,059 and as low as $26,176, the majority of Lab Operations Manager salaries currently range between $34,600 (25th percentile) to $65,400 (75th percentile) with top earners (90th percentile) making $91,615 annually in Georgia. The average pay range for a Lab Operations Manager varies greatly (by as much as 30800), which suggests there may be many opportunities for advancement and increased pay based on skill level, location and years of experience.

    Georgia ranks number 50 out of 50 states nationwide for Lab Operations Manager salaries.
